The Process

Mitsubishi vehicles come with a variety of convenient features that make driving more enjoyable. The key fob is one of the most useful features, allowing you to lock and unlock the vehicle remotely. However, if you notice your key fob appears to be failing or not working in any way, the issue could be due to the battery is dead. It's an easy fix.

Begin by gathering the materials. Included in this is a brand new battery, and a small screwdriver. You can open the door of the Mitsubishi key fob using the screwdriver. There should be two tiny seams at bottom of the fob. Use your screwdriver with care between these seams to separate the door and expose the battery.

Once you have opened the fob, take out the old battery and replace it with a new one. Be sure to dispose of the old batteries properly. After replacing the battery, shut the door and re-attach the key to your vehicle. You can now test the Mitsubishi key fob and make sure that it is working properly.

The Tools

Modern Mitsubishi automobiles are fitted with a range of features that make driving easier. Key fobs are one of the most useful features. It allows drivers to lock their vehicle, unlock it, and even turn on the motor remotely. Fort Myers Mitsubishi is here to assist you in the event that your key fob stops working or doesn't connect to your vehicle.

The most common reason for the key fob being disconnected is a dead battery. To stop this from happening, you can follow a straightforward procedure to replace the battery on your Mitsubishi key fob. It's all you need is a CR2032 and some basic tools to complete the task.

To begin, take off the Mitsubishi key fob from your keychain. find a small notch at the top of the device. In the indentation, use a flat screwdriver, then open the keyfob. Replace the old battery with a fresh one, making sure to use the positive (+) or upward-facing side of the new battery is facing upwards. Reassemble the keyfob once you have installed the new battery.

Once the key fob is put back together, reattach it to your keychain and test out its functions. If everything works as expected you can now drive your Mitsubishi with absolute confidence. You can also test the key fob's remote start feature and power liftgate open and close features to check if they're functioning as well.

SEAT-Logo-2019.jpgThe Materials

If your Mitsubishi key fob is unresponsive, it may be due to a programming issue or a dead battery. It is possible to solve the problem yourself in the event that it's the latter. The procedure is easy and takes only a few minutes. You'll need a few CR2032 batteries as well as a small screwdriver with a flat head to unlock the key fob and replace the old battery.

Start by removing the key made of steel from the fob. Find the indentation on the top and twist it with the flat end of the screwdriver. The old battery will be visible inside. Remove it and replace it with a new one. Be cautious when removing the old battery to prevent causing damage to the circuit board and buttons. When you are trying to remove the battery, it's simple to pull out the circuit or move the buttons.

Subaru-logo.pngMake sure you use a screwdriver with an extremely slim tip, not one with a wide head, because this could cause damage to your fob. Also, it's recommended to snap a photo of the fob's interior before you begin to ensure you can reference points for when you plug the battery back in later. The key fobs can differ quite a bit one model to the other and this will make it less likely of confusing yourself when you reassemble the fob.

To begin, you will require some essential items. Included in this are a flathead screwdriver and a new battery. Some key fobs have a notch on their sides that makes them easier to pry apart. However, it is crucial not to apply excessive force. If you do, the fob may be able to open and scatter bits all over your living space. Instead, it is best to gently push the screwdriver around the edges of the case.

After opening the case, take out the battery and replace it with a brand new one. The new battery is a CR2032 calculator battery, similar to the ones made by Maxell or Panasonic. After installing the new battery, close the case and then press the case back together. Then, test the device to make sure it functions properly.
